    Welcoming Patrick Supanc as Coursera’s New Chief Product Officer

    By Greg Hart, Coursera CEO

    I’m excited to announce that Patrick Supanc has joined Coursera as our new Chief Product Officer, starting today.

    Patrick brings a wealth of experience, combining a deep understanding of customer needs with a proven track record of driving innovation and business impact. Over nearly ten years at Amazon, he helped scale products like Prime, Amazon Hub, and Kindle, and before that, he led digital learning innovations at Pearson and Blackboard. His background in both technology and education makes him the ideal leader to drive product strategy and deliver innovative experiences for learners, partners, and customers worldwide.

    Patrick holds an AB in Public and International Affairs from Princeton University and a Master of Public Policy in Political and Economic Development from Harvard Kennedy School. 

    I also want to recognize the exceptional work of our product and engineering teams, whose dedication and innovation have driven Coursera’s momentum over the past year. From the launch of AI translations, Coursera Coach, and Course Builder — just months after ChatGPT’s release — to our recent introductions of AI-dubbed courses and career-based discovery, their contributions have helped Coursera deliver world-class learning experiences at scale.

    As we expand our leadership team, we’re excited to continue building on this momentum — delivering innovative learning experiences and creating more opportunities for our global community. Please join me in welcoming Patrick as we work together to shape the future of learning.
